THE WOODLANDS, Texas, Aug. 04, 2020 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- LGI Homes, Inc.(NASDAQ: LGIH) today announced financial results for the second quarter and six months ended June 30, 2020.

Second Quarter 2020 Highlights and Comparisons to Second Quarter 2019

-- Net Income increased 20.8% to $55.6 million, or $2.22 Basic EPS and $2.21 Diluted EPS -- Net Income Before Income Taxes increased 13.3% to $68.6 million -- Home Sales Revenues increased 4.3% to $481.6 million -- Home Closings increased 3.1% to 2,005 homes -- Average Home Sales Price increased 1.1% to $240,200 -- Gross Margin as a Percentage of Homes Sales Revenues increased 40 basis points to 24.5% -- Adjusted Gross Margin (non-GAAP) as a Percentage of Home Sales Revenues increased 30 basis points to 26.6% -- Active Selling Communities at June30, 2020 increased 25.8% to 117 -- Total Owned and Controlled Lots decreased to 44,307 lots at June30, 2020

2020 Second Quarter Results

Home closings during the second quarter of 2020 totaled 2,005, an increase of 3.1% from 1,944 home closings during the second quarter of 2019. At the end of the second quarter, active selling communities increased to 117, up from 93 communities at the end of the second quarter of 2019.

Home sales revenues for the second quarter of 2020 were $481.6 million, an increase of $19.8 million, or 4.3%, over the second quarter of 2019. The increase in home sales revenues is primarily due to the increase in home closings and an increase in the average home sales price during the second quarter of 2020.

The average home sales price for the second quarter of 2020 was $240,200, an increase of $2,633, or 1.1%, over the second quarter of 2019. This increase in the average home sales price was primarily due to changes in product mix, higher price points in certain new markets and a favorable pricing environment.

Gross margin as a percentage of home sales revenues for the second quarter of 2020 was 24.5% as compared to 24.1% for the second quarter of 2019. Adjusted gross margin (non-GAAP) as a percentage of home sales revenues for the second quarter of 2020 was 26.6% as compared to 26.3% for the second quarter of 2019. The increase in gross margin and adjusted gross margin as a percentage of home sales revenues is primarily due to operating leverage and lower capitalized interest costs recognized in the second quarter of 2020 as compared to the second quarter of 2019. Please see Non-GAAP Measures for a reconciliation of adjusted gross margin (non-GAAP) to gross margin, the most comparable GAAP measure.

Net income for the second quarter of 2020 was $55.6 million, or $2.22 per basic share and $2.21 per diluted share, an increase of $9.6 million, or 20.8%, from $46.1 million, or $2.01 per basic share and $1.82 per diluted share, for the second quarter of 2019. The increase in net income is primarily attributed to operating leverage realized from the increase in home sales revenues, higher average home sales price and retroactive tax benefit recognized during the second quarter of 2020 as compared to the second quarter of 2019.

Results for the Six Months Ended June 30, 2020

Home closings for the six months ended June 30, 2020 totaled 3,840, an increase of 21.1%, from 3,172 home closings during the six months ended June 30, 2019.

Home sales revenues for the six months ended June 30, 2020 were $936.3 million, an increase of $186.9 million, or 24.9%, over the six months ended June 30, 2019. The increase in home sales revenues is primarily due to the increase in home closings and an increase in the average home sales price during the six months ended June 30, 2020.

The average home sales price for the six months ended June 30, 2020 was $243,836, an increase of $7,574, or 3.2%, over the six months ended June 30, 2019. This increase in the average home sales price was primarily due to changes in product mix and higher price points in certain new markets, partially offset by additional wholesale home closings.

Gross margin as a percentage of home sales revenues for the six months ended June 30, 2020 was 24.0% as compared to 23.7% for the six months ended June 30, 2019. Adjusted gross margin (non-GAAP) as a percentage of home sales revenues for the six months ended June 30, 2020 was 26.1% as compared to 25.8% for the six months ended June 30, 2019. The increase in gross margin and adjusted gross margin as a percentage of home sales revenues is primarily due to higher average home sales price fueled by our product mix, a favorable pricing environment and operating leverage obtained, partially offset by an increase in wholesale home closings as a percentage of total home closings in the six months ended June 30, 2020 as compared to the six months ended June 30, 2019. Please see Non-GAAP Measures for a reconciliation of adjusted gross margin (non-GAAP) to gross margin, the most comparable GAAP measure.

Net income for the six months ended June 30, 2020 was $98.5 million, or $3.91 per basic share and $3.88 per diluted share, an increase of $34.1 million, or 52.9%, from $64.4 million, or $2.82 per basic share and $2.55 per diluted share, for the six months ended June 30, 2019. The increase in net income is primarily attributed to an increase in the number of homes closed with an overall higher gross margin percentage, as a result of higher average home sales price and retroactive tax benefit recognized during the six months ended June 30, 2020 as compared to the six months ended June 30, 2019.

OutlookSubject to the caveats in the Forward-Looking Statements section of this press release, the Company offers the following guidance for the full year 2020. The Company believes:

-- Home closings will be between 8,000 and 8,800 in 2020 -- Active selling communities at the end of 2020 will be between 115 and 125 -- Gross margin as a percentage of home sales revenues will be between 24.0% and 25.0% -- Adjusted gross margin (non-GAAP) as a percentage of home sales revenues will be in the range of 26.0% and 27.0% with capitalized interest accounting for substantially all of the difference between gross margin and adjusted gross margin -- Average home sales price will be between $245,000 and $255,000 -- SG&A as a percentage of home sales revenues will be between 10.5% and 11.0% -- Effective tax rate will be between 21.0% and 22.0%

This outlook assumes that general economic conditions, including interest rates and mortgage availability, in the remainder of 2020 are similar to those experienced so far in the third quarter of 2020 and that average home sales price, construction costs, availability of land, land development costs and overall absorption rates in the remainder of 2020 are consistent with the Companys recent experience. In addition, this outlook assumes that governmental regulations relating to land development, home construction and COVID-19 are similar to those currently in place. Any further COVID-19 governmental restrictions on land development or home construction could negatively impact our ability to achieve this guidance.

About LGI Homes, Inc.

Headquartered in The Woodlands, Texas, LGI Homes, Inc. engages in the design, construction and sale of homes in Texas, Arizona, Florida, Georgia, New Mexico, Colorado, North Carolina, South Carolina, Washington, Tennessee, Minnesota, Oklahoma, Alabama, California, Oregon, Nevada, West Virginia and Virginia. LGI Homes secured its place as the 10th largest residential builder in United States in 2018 based on units closed and remains there today. The Company has a notable legacy of more than 17 years of homebuilding operations, over which time it has closed more than 40,000 homes. Non-GAAP Measures

In addition to the results reported in accordance with U.S. GAAP, the Company has provided information in this press release relating to adjusted gross margin.

Adjusted gross margin is a non-GAAP financial measure used by management as a supplemental measure in evaluating operating performance. The Company defines adjusted gross margin as gross margin less capitalized interest and adjustments resulting from the application of purchase accounting included in the cost of sales. Management believes this information is useful because it isolates the impact that capitalized interest and purchase accounting adjustments have on gross margin. However, because adjusted gross margin information excludes capitalized interest and purchase accounting adjustments, which have real economic effects and could impact results, the utility of adjusted gross margin information as a measure of operating performance may be limited. In addition, other companies may not calculate adjusted gross margin information in the same manner that the Company does. Accordingly, adjusted gross margin information should be considered only as a supplement to gross margin information as a measure of the Companys performance.
